Anion dependent self-assembly of a linear hexanuclear Yb(iii) salen complex with enhanced near-infrared (NIR) luminescence properties

Abstract

Reactions of H2salen (H2L, N,N′-ethylene bis(salicylideneimine)) with Yb(CF3SO3)3, Yb(OAc)3·4H2O and Yb(NO3)3·6H2O in MeOH–EtOH under reflux gave NIR luminescent complexes [Yb6L9(H2L)2] (1), [Yb3L3(HL)(OH)2] (2) and [Yb2L2(H2L)2(NO3)(MeOH)2]·NO3 (3), respectively.
